Transaction 7f72e63d4831dc417b0f90ca22136bee12b3bc0c235e4ff33fbb45ecaf649aa9

2 Input
2 Outputs
  • 7f72e63d4831dc417b0f90ca22136bee12b3bc0c235e4ff33fbb45ecaf649aa9:0
  • value  622800
    address  3DdvYjT8XPzfoAf7YWhURiPHrQ6gCmSvyg
  • 7f72e63d4831dc417b0f90ca22136bee12b3bc0c235e4ff33fbb45ecaf649aa9:1
  • value  9771762
    address  35HvndFp3Arq285p323aByTkAFdr1PSCba